Marathon, Florida UFO Sightings Analysis
We analyzed all 17 UFO sighting reports in Marathon, Florida to identify possible patterns and gain insight into the phenomenon:
- The most commonly reported UFO shape or appearance is "fireball" (3 reports, 17.65% of total).
- January is the month with the most reported UFO sightings (5 reports, 29.41% of total).
- Monday is the weekday with the most reported UFO sightings (5 reports, 29.41% of total).
- 2022 is the year with the most UFO sightings reported (2 reports, 11.76% of total).
- 06/17/19 is the single date with the most UFO sightings reported (1 reports, 5.88% of total).
- Sightings occur more often during the night, between the hours of 20:00 - 23:59 (8 reports, 47.06% of total).

5 transparent rectangular shapes, in formation, at night, over ocean, the lit up shapes moved fast, vertically, then light went out. On the night of either July 6th or 7th, 2016 about 11:00pm-11:30, in Marathon Key, Fl. my husband and I were sitting in front of the Atlantic Ocean, both looking up at the stars in the sky.
There were a few clouds around and a fair amount of stars, which was all we saw. We had been there approx. 10 or 15 min.
looking into the sky. My husband was sitting to my left and looking to his left, and I glanced to my right. I saw 5 transparent rectangular shapes that were lit up, in a V or horseshoe formation, in the sky, above the horizon.
They were not moving, they were very large and defined, all exactly alike, covering a good amount of sky, and they were not solid; I could see right through them to the sky behind them. I distinctly recall seeing a wispy cloud floating by in one of the rectangles. I didn’t see where the source of this huge pattern of light could be coming from, and in an instant they moved very rapidly, all together, upward in the sky, in a q! uick vertical motion and the “light” went out.
I did not hear any sound. The sky was then exactly as it had been: dark, with stars. This all happened in probably 2 seconds; I was just about to say to my husband, “Do you see this?” but didn’t have time! I’ve never seen anything like this in my 53 years and I’m not one for flights of fancy.
The only thing I can think of to compare it to (in a way), was some years ago when I was on a stargazing trip out on a boat and the tour guide had one of those laser pointers, which he would very briefly, point into the sky--- I remember how far the light seemed to travel and the way it lit up the sky in the area he pointed to….this rectangular light reminded me of that. But I’m not familiar with lasers and if they would be capable of doing the above as I described, with this huge shape and pattern.
So I decided to search online and report what I saw here. ((NUFORC Note: Witness indicates that the date of the sighting is approximate. PD)).

Two cluster of lights stationary in sky 45 degrees off horizon January 20, 2009 Marathon, Florida About 5:00 AM EST I observed two close packed clusters of lights (no observable space between the lights) from my window looking northward on the gulf side of Marathon in the Florida Keys that remained stationary in the sky about 45 degrees off the horizon. I watched them long enough to be sure they were not aircraft or satellites. The one on the west from my vantage point was slightly higher than the one toward the east.
They were about 10 degrees apart. The right hand cluster blinked very slowly approximately every two to three seconds it would disappear for two to three seconds. At one point a very bright and fast ball of light shot down all the way to the horizon from the left hand cluster.
Having seen many shooting stars I knew that I was not observing one. During the five minutes I observed this happened only once. The two groups of lights remained in the same position in the sky during my entire observation.
I am a 63 year old college educated female ((NUFORC Note: Witness elects to remain totally anonymous; provides no contact information. PD)).

Lights on black object over road in FL Keys. We were driving toward Key West from Miami on US1 at about 12:30am last night (Saturday night). I was driving over a bridge and in the distance I saw something with a green and red light.
I noticed it and told my friend I thought it was the balloon that transmits Radio Marti to Cuba. (Many people may not know-the US government has a large balloon loacted at Cudjoe Key, FL that transmits Radio Marti to Cuba). I have seen the balloon in the daytime and assumed that's what I was seeing last night.
Right away I noticed we were still far away from Cudjoe Key. At first I thought maybe they put another balloon up. Anyway, as we got closer to whatever it was, I noticed the lights were very noticeable.
I saw a red light and a green light. I was concentrating on seeing if it was a balloon, so I was looking mostly below the lights. I noticed it was not attached to anything and there was no tower below the lights.
It was also too low to be a plane. My friend was looking out the passenger window and said he saw a white light and a red light. He did not see the green light that I originally saw.
When we got closer to the lights, they moved from my side of the truck because the road hadn't curved but I couldn't see them anymore. My friend said whatever it was moved, and he saw it more over the road. He saw a red and white light 100 to 250 feet hovering directly over the highway.
He also saw a black mass between the lights in what looked like a triangle but didn't totally point at the top. From his account the white light was on the top and he saw a red light on the corner of one of the bottom of the points. There was never any sound it made.
We opened the windows of the truck when we were close to it, and it was just quiet. I kept driving looking for a place to turn around because there was a car right behind me. I had to go about 1000 feet before I saw a driveway to turn around.
When we went back, there was nothing there. No lights, and we looked to see if there was anything in the air it could have been, and again nothing. It was as if it just disappeared.
We had not had anything to drink last night or anything like that. We shared a pack of cheese crackers but I don't think that would give us any hallucinations. I can't explain what I saw but I have many questions that I didn't have before.
My friend thought it was a ship of some kind right after seeing it.
